Welcome to Day #8 of Chocolate and Peru Theme Week.
Today's 70% Dark Chocolate Peru (bar) was made from bean-to-bar by Xocolatl LLC (Atlanta, GA). Xocolatl, the company's packaging reminds us, "was the original Aztec word for chocolate."
The cacao used to make this bar was "directly sourced from the Cooperativa Agraria Cafetalera, a cooperative of coffee & cacao farmers in Pangoa, Peru." (San Martin de Pangoa is located in the Central Amazon region of Peru.)
Aroma and flavor notes for this bar included: confidently complex (smooth but assertive) dark chocolate with tart fruit (cherry, lemon preserves) and medium acidity. Very faint butter, warm spice. Medium-to-long finish.
Speculation: If I had to guess the cacao variety...This dark chocolate reminded me of a Trinitario-like cacao variety--with relatively bold cocoa, fruit and citrus notes; and less like some Forastero cacao varieties that are more dark and dense (less 3-dimensional, with less complex fruit).
I enjoyed this well-executed and thoughtfully sourced dark chocolate. The balanced fullness of the tart and jammy cacao flavors (all made possible from just three organic ingredients) was especially satisfying.
